MID vs SUS Match Analysis
The match will take place at the iconic Lord’s Cricket Ground in London. The game is scheduled for a 6:30 PM local time start, promising a cool evening under the floodlights with a good cricketing atmosphere.
Middlesex have had a rollercoaster ride in the T20 Blast over recent years. The side combines experience with fresh blood, but inconsistency continues to dog their campaign. However, with a few key players hitting form, they’ll hope to give their home crowd something to cheer.
Sussex, on the other hand, arrive with a team filled with international pedigree and youthful exuberance. Led by the pace-heavy artillery, they’ve often outclassed opposition with both ball and bat. After a heartbreaking semi-final loss last season, they’ll be looking to assert early dominance in this year’s campaign.

In their last encounter against Sussex at Brighton on July 19, 2024, Middlesex posted 159/9, with the innings showing occasional promise but lacking a strong finish. Sussex chased the total down effortlessly, reaching 161/1 in just 16.2 overs. It was a dominant performance from Sussex, who won by 9 wickets with 22 balls remaining.

In the 2nd Semi-Final against Gloucestershire at Birmingham on September 14, 2024, Sussex faltered with the bat, being bowled out for 106. Gloucestershire chased the target with ease, scoring 109/2 in 13.4 overs. Sussex’s batting collapse cost them the match and a place in the final.

MID vs SUS Outfield Report
Lord’s, London
The Lord’s pitch generally offers a true bounce and good carry for pacers in the early overs. Batters who settle can enjoy stroke-making freedom, especially under lights. Spinners may struggle to grip the ball unless there’s some dryness.
The weather forecast for May 29 suggests clear skies with light breezes and minimal humidity. The temperature is expected to hover around 18°C to 20°C, making it ideal for an evening T20 fixture.
The average first innings total in T20s at Lord’s hovers around the 165-run mark, indicating a balanced. Teams batting first have occasionally crossed 190, while below-par scores hover near 140. Chasing under lights has proven slightly easier due to consistent bounce and outfield speed.
